Output ab6e5ec542406664596df1d11d24829729ecd32f4f3cb859c8924e0d96bb108c:1

value
19407511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02334b3ca2f32527364ffda5af2933a5594aa38a OP_EQUAL
address
31teitZ2xMdbYv1ZU59PThKmwEDrfhXW4A
transaction
ab6e5ec542406664596df1d11d24829729ecd32f4f3cb859c8924e0d96bb108c
spent
true